你查询的IP:[121.4.73.34]  地理位置:中国–上海–上海

最新查询122.64.3.21 61.48.27.43 60.63.244.0 117.8.81.41 58.30.34.50 60.55.93.41 59.80.250.0 121.32.9.16 116.1.86.17 121.4.73.34 116.248.130.18 60.232.60.215 124.64.37.128 117.22.222.46 192.83.122.37 118.91.240.224 116.199.126.230 122.144.128.226 202.136.208.208 202.61.110.18 202.153.48.29 119.40.128.146 210.2.228.238 123.196.20.230 125.169.116.198 119.112.136.168 121.55.75.237 116.198.4.198 121.48.74.223 118.184.23.185 60.160.185.114